| Metric | £29,425 | £43,316 | Difference |
|---|---|---|---|
| Gross Salary | £29,425 | £43,316 | £13,891 |
| Income Tax | £3,371 | £6,149 | £2,778 |
| National Insurance | £1,348 | £2,460 | £1,111 |
| Pension | £0 | £0 | £0 |
| Take-Home Pay (Yearly) | £24,706 | £34,707 | £10,002 |
| Take-Home (Monthly) | £2,059 | £2,892 | £833 |
| Effective Tax Rate | 16.0% | 19.9% | 3.8% |
